Franklyn G. Prendergast is a scholar working on Molecular Biology, Spectroscopy and Materials Chemistry. According to data from OpenAlex, Franklyn G. Prendergast has authored 118 papers receiving a total of 7.1k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 82 papers in Molecular Biology, 25 papers in Spectroscopy and 22 papers in Materials Chemistry. Recurrent topics in Franklyn G. Prendergast’s work include Protein Structure and Dynamics (35 papers), Enzyme Structure and Function (17 papers) and Mass Spectrometry Techniques and Applications (14 papers). Franklyn G. Prendergast is often cited by papers focused on Protein Structure and Dynamics (35 papers), Enzyme Structure and Function (17 papers) and Mass Spectrometry Techniques and Applications (14 papers). Franklyn G. Prendergast collaborates with scholars based in United States, Russia and Spain. Franklyn G. Prendergast's co-authors include Enrico Gratton, J. Alcalá, John R. Blinks, S.Yu. Venyaminov, W. Gil Wier, Peter Hess, Kenneth G. Mann, Richard P. Haugland, James E. Whitaker and David G. Allen and has published in prestigious journals such as Nature, Science and Journal of the American Chemical Society.
